* Introduce board_init_f_mem() to handle early memory layoutSimon Glass2015-02-121-0/+18
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| At present on some architectures we set up the following before calling board_init_f(): - global_data - stack - early malloc memory Adding the code to support early malloc and global data setup to every arch's assembler start-up is a pain. Also this code is not actually architecture-specific. We can use common code for all architectures and with a bit of care we can write this code in C. Add a new function to deal with this. It should be called after memory is available, with a pointer to the top of the area that should be used before relocation. The function will set things up and return the lowest memory address that it allocated/used. That can then be set as the top of the stack. Note that on some archs this function will use the stack, so the stack pointer should be set to same value as is pased to board_init_f_mem(). A margin of 128 bytes will be left for this stack, so that it is not overwritten. This means that 64 bytes is wasted by this early call. This is not strictly necessary on several more modern archs, so we could remove this at the cost of some arch-dependent code. With this function there is no-longer any need for the assembler code to zero global_data or set up the early malloc pointers. Signed-off-by: Simon Glass <sjg@chromium.org>
* malloc_simple: Return NULL on malloc failure rather then calling panic()Hans de Goede2015-02-121-1/+1
| | | | | | | | | | | | | | | All callers of malloc should already do error checking, and may even be able to continue without the alloc succeeding. Moreover, common/malloc_simple.c is the only user of .rodata.str1.1 in common/built-in.o when building the SPL, triggering this gcc bug: https://gcc.gnu.org/bugzilla/show_bug.cgi?id=54303 Causing .rodata to grow with e.g. 0xc21 bytes, nullifying all benefits of using malloc_simple in the first place. | * x86: quark: Add routines to access message bus registersBin Meng2015-02-062-0/+183
| | | | | | | | | | | | | | | | | | | | | | In the Quark SoC, some chipset commands are accomplished by utilizing the internal message network within the host bridge (D0:F0). Accesses to this network are accomplished by populating the message control register (MCR), Message Control Register eXtension (MCRX) and the message data register (MDR).
